Pinacotheca Hamptoniana is a 1719 by George Bickham, a Baroque work, held at Victoria and Albert Museum.
This painting is a title page for a book of prints. It shows a collection of prints. The prints are copies of big designs by Raphael. He made them for tapestries. The designs are really big - over 10 feet high. This title page is interesting because it helps people learn about Raphael's work. Check out the work of artist Bickham, George.
